🎉Proud to present our latest paper, out now in Nature Communications: www.nature.com/articles/s41... RNA Binding Proteins (RBPs) are often full of intrinsically disordered regions (IDRs), but what these regions do during RNA recognition is often unclear. 1/10 #RNA #IDR #RBP

LARP6 is an EMT-associated RNA-binding protein with diverse RNA targets. Here, the authors show that the N-terminal disordered region of LARP6 promotes RNA-binding selectivity by modulating the adjace...

Harris Snell et al. report that ZC3H7A and ZC3H7B, two chordate-specific RNA-binding proteins, directly bind and coordinate the decay and translational regulation of A/U3-rich non-optimal mRNAs. By re...

Kretov et al. introduce RBPscan, an RNA-editing-based platform that measures how RNA-binding proteins engage their targets in living cells. This approach quantifies the binding strength of protein-RNA...

Max Fels @mfels.bsky.social from our lab discovers giant DNA viruses that infect amoeba encode eIF4E and the entire suite of 4F complex proteins to control mRNA translation, including beautiful crystal structures of viral 4E bound to modified mRNA 5' caps: www.cell.com/cell/fulltex...
